Some good advice here, but I want to add something from a less "theological" position and from a more "practical" position...

While we should in fact lay our troubles before the Lord, and trust the future to Him, we also have a responsibility to use the good brains that God gave us..

We are not suppose to take a fatalistic view and just sit back and throw up our hands and say "ok God, you do it"!

We have the responsibility to make plans, to set goals, to plan out our direction - BUT knowing that God is the one in control, and will guide us in whatever direction we should go. And of course to pray for direction and listen to His voice.

Go ahead and plan, but first go to God in prayer and ask him to guide you, to "direct your steps". Then trust God as you make your plans, somehow God will guide in a way that even your mistakes will be used for good.

However, check now and then whether your life is lining up with the values of Jesus as they written down in the Holy Bible. When you find your life is off track and moving away from the values of Jesus, confess your sins, and then repent, which means turn to God, then ask God to fill and control you by Holy Spirit (see Ephesians 5:17-18). Delibrately seeking God to fill and control you by Holy Spirit is the most effective way to successfully live the Christian life (Read Romans 8).
